Enuma Elish

Order is not given but won: Marduk becomes king of the gods only after defeating the chaos-sea Tiamat in single combat, and creation itself is built from her corpse.

Babylon's creation epic, recited during the Akitu New Year festival, recounts a war among the gods that ends when the young god Marduk kills the primordial sea-mother Tiamat and splits her body to form sky and earth. Humanity is fashioned afterward from the blood of a defeated rebel god to serve the gods, and Marduk's kingship over the pantheon mirrors and legitimizes Babylon's own political supremacy.
